POSITION TITLE: Liturgy Coordinator & Cathedral Curator

DEPARTMENT: Divine Worship

REPORTS TO: Director of Liturgical Formation / Associate Director of Music

CLASSIFICATION: Regular, Full-Time, Ministerial

HOURS PER WEEK: 40

POSITION SUMMARY
This Liturgy Coordinator and Cathedral Curator is responsible for assisting the Archbishop of Omaha in his episcopal role as chief liturgist of the archdiocese and head of Saint Cecilia Cathedral, providing ceremonial leadership and direction for ministers of the liturgy at events of greater importance at the Cathedral, including the development of local parish ministers. Additionally, this individual collaborates with the Office of the Chancellor to curate archdiocesan artistic patrimony on the cathedral campus.

P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
• Coordination with the Cathedral Rector and Archdiocesan Master of Ceremonies for archdiocesan liturgies and those liturgies when the archbishop is present throughout the year.
• Assistance to the Cathedral Rector for cathedral liturgies, confirmations, graduations, and similar large-scale liturgies, as requested.
• Assistance to the Cathedral Rector in the formation and training of sacristans and other liturgical ministers of the cathedral.
• Coordination of liturgical ministers for archdiocesan liturgies.
• Planning and directing of rehearsals for archdiocesan liturgies.
• Collaboration with the Cathedral Sacristan and Office of Divine Worship staff in preparation for liturgies.
• Collaboration with Facilities Manager, Flower Guild, and other pertinent stakeholders in the seasonal liturgical decoration of the cathedral interior.
• Oversight of stocking of adequate liturgical supplies for the cathedral.
• Curation of the Spanish Colonial Collection, Vestment & Liturgical Garment Archive, Kimball Archive, Cathedral Museum, and Sunderland Gallery, including maintenance, restoration, accession, disposition, and publicity.
• Serve as liaison between the Cathedral Arts Project and both the cathedral and Office of Divine Worship.
• Collaborate with cathedral staff for the ongoing maintenance and development of the cathedral building, interior and exterior.
• Collaborate with the cathedral staff regarding regular maintenance that impacts the visual and aural artistic environment.
